Q1: How does the electric plaster saw prevent injury to the patient's skin?
A1: The saw blade utilizes high-speed oscillation rather than rotation. When in contact with rigid plaster or fiberglass bandages, it cuts easily, but when it touches soft, elastic skin, the skin absorbs the vibration and deflects without being cut.

Q3: Is the cutting speed of the bandage cutter adjustable?
A3: Yes, the plaster saw features a variable speed control frequency ranging from 0 to 12,500 rpm, allowing operators to adjust the speed dynamically according to the thickness and material of the cast.
Q4: What is the noise level during operation?
A4: The no-load noise level of the motor is ≤80dB. The optimized design ensures lower noise and minimal vibration during clinical cast removals, creating a more comfortable environment for patients.
Q5: What safety protections does the motor feature?
A5: The motor is designed with a double insulation protection device, which ensures absolute safety for both the medical operator and the patient during operation.
